11 South Grove, Highgate Village, the historic home of the HLSI
The Highgate Literary and Scientific Institution (HLSI) was founded in 1839 with the aim of helping local people to better understand new developments in industry and discoveries in science. It is now one the few surviving membership supported organisations which predate the widespread establishment of public libraries in the UK. Today its charitable purpose, from its Grade II listed building in the centre of Highgate Village, in north London, is to offer opportunities for life-long learning through its courses, library, archives, art gallery, lectures, debates, cultural and social events
